Schallfeld Ensemble – Voices of Today

October 3 @ 13:00

Programme

PATRICIA ALESSANDRINI (b. 1970) A place no one lives for soprano and ensemble (an extended version for live performance) (world première) [1]

BEAT FURRER (b. 1954) Aria for soprano and six instruments

EDA ER (b. 1989) Happily Ever After

PATRICIA ALESSANDRINI New commission (for 2 sopranos and ensemble) (world première) [1]

[1] Commissioned by Wigmore Hall (with the generous support of the Marchus Trust and the Wigmore Hall Endowment Fund)


Overview

Patricia Alessandrini’s intricate sound sculptures encompass a seemingly unlimited range of tonal colours and textures, both acoustic and electronic. The American composer and sound artist, whose teachers include Tristan Murail and Thea Musgrave, received praise from Gramophone for ‘her formidably disciplined manipulation of febrile emotions’. Her captivating art, including a major new composition, is complemented by the restless energy of Beat Furrer’s Aria from 1998-9.
